Kuwait sees decline in kidnapping, rape, and honor-related crimes in first half of 2026

Kuwait’s Minister of Justice Nasser Al-Sumait announced a significant drop in severe crimes during the first half of 2026, with kidnapping cases falling by 45.5 percent compared to the same period last year.

Reported on August 17, 2026, statistics also showed a 28 percent decline in honor-related crimes and a 50 percent drop in cases of rape by force or threat. Al-Sumait attributed the positive indicators to legislative reforms, enhanced penal systems, and stronger legal protections for vulnerable groups in society.
